Royal Greenhouse, Laeken, Belgium

The annual opening of Belgium's Royal Greenhouses at Laeken is one of Europe's must-see spring events. The elaborate steel and glass complex, designed in 1873 by Alphonse Balat, is home to many rare and valuable plant species, including varieties of azaleas and geraniums, which come into full bloom during the three-week opening.
